Output ddf8a4500055897aad14fe61cea6802d32669c25ce86fdc239b217f4e27d8eae:0

value
106151651
script pubkey
OP_HASH160 OP_PUSHBYTES_20 515519c3050feb192ae63d165755875f0bd3df1f OP_EQUAL
address
3974byesFRvtMWv7CJN7nkQ5ki5F8DyxPj
transaction
ddf8a4500055897aad14fe61cea6802d32669c25ce86fdc239b217f4e27d8eae
confirmations
244092
spent
true